Output 53868f942aa9c69114e4dd97be9e405447c124fb1579fa28281527fad5f11f8e:0

value
15868
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 317af12ae20b99f51ebf0a5eaa21bd03f12aa5fda89ed912f5c0b7e071d13739
address
bc1px9a0z2hzpwvl284lpf025gdaq0cj4f0a4z0djyh4czm7quw3xuusyls8qk
transaction
53868f942aa9c69114e4dd97be9e405447c124fb1579fa28281527fad5f11f8e